Legend. Mechanism of action of carbonic anhydrase inhibitor diuretics. Bicarbonate absorption by the proximal tubule is dependent on the activity of carbonic anhydrase (CA) which converts bicarbonate (HCO 3-) to CO 2 and H 2 O. CO2 rapidly diffuses across the cell membrane of proximal tubule cells where it is rehydrated back to H 2 CO 3 by carbonic anhydrase. The Mechanism of Action of Diuretics. Inhibitors of carbonic anhydrase presently have a limited role in the treatment of epilepsy. Inorganic anions, such as I в€’, CN в€’, SH в€’, CNO в€’, SCN в€’, and Br в€’, and sulfonamides are inhibitors of the enzyme carbonic anhydrase (Maren 1967). Both bromides and sulfonamides have been used in the treatment of epilepsy in man..

12.1 Mechanism of Action . Carbonic anhydrase (CA) is an enzyme found in many tissues of the body including the eye. It catalyzes the reversible reaction involving the hydration of carbon dioxide and the dehydration of carbonic acid.
